Goldman Sachs BDC's stock was trading at $9.29 at the start of the year. Since then, GSBD stock has increased by 3.3% and is now trading at $9.5950.

Goldman Sachs BDC, Inc. (NYSE:GSBD) released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May, 7th. The financial services provider reported $0.22 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.29 by $0.07. The financial services provider earned $10.35 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$83.78 million. Goldman Sachs BDC had a trailing twelve-month return on equity of 10.94% and a net margin of 21.32%.

Goldman Sachs BDC (GSBD) raised $123 million in an initial public offering (IPO) on Wednesday, March 18th 2015. The company issued 6,000,000 shares at $20.00-$21.00 per share. BofA Merrill Lynch, Goldman Sachs, Morgan Stanley, Citigroup, Credit Suisse and Wells Fargo Securities served as the underwriters for the IPO and Raymond James and SunTrust Robinson Humphrey were co-managers.
